The tour starts at the Boat Landing Guesthouse or the Green Discovery office in town. After a short orientation on the use of mountain bikes, we will start cycling on the road to Muang Sing. The support vehicle (tuk-tuk) will follow soon with luggage and water. Lunch on the way. On this first day, we cycle 59 km over the mountains through the Nam Ha National Protected Area to Muang Sing. The slope up to Kiew Lom Pass is long and gradual. Once we reach the top of the pass, it will be a swift descent to the valley floor. Once we checked into the guesthouse, go for a stroll to see what's up in the town. A traditional Tai Leu dinner is served at a Tai Leu restaurant.
Approximately: 5-6 hours biking
End of 1 day tour: For the hard bikers, you may like cycle back to Luang Nam Tha the same day. For those who want something easy, the support vehicle can take you to the top of the pass and you can coast down to Muang Sing and later do the same on the way back. Total distance is 59 km one way (Approximately: 1 ½ hour transfer/ 6 hours cycling)
We visit the market before breakfast. After breakfast, we start pedaling at 8:30 back towards Luang Namtha. We cycle 6 km up the Stupa Mountain to visit Muang Sing’s most sacred site. Then we go back down on the road and on to Ban Sop I Mai, an Akha village, where we will leave the road and ride along the foot of the hills towards the Chinese border. We will pass through Ban Boong Kawp, another Akha village, and Ban Phoudonthan, an Iu Mien village. We have lunch at a guesthouse near the Chinese border.
After lunch, we ride up to the border. We turn around and go back on the road for a short while before turning right, while leaving the road once again. We ride through 4 different Akha villages until coming back to the road at Ban Nakham, a Tai Leu village. Return to the guesthouse in Muang Sing. Dinner is served at the Tai Leu Guesthouse.
Approximately: 5- 6 hours biking
End of 2 days tour: You may opt to ride to Luang Namtha (Distance 59 Km; Time approximately 1 ½ hour transfer / 6 hours cycling)
We start in the morning by riding for a while on the road back to Luang Namtha. But before reaching the Stupa Mountain, we turn left to go to Ban Koum to visit a rice liquor distillation. We then pedal on small back roads to Ban Yaluang, an Akha village, and further across hills and fields to 3 other Akha villages. We have an Akha lunch in Ban Houeina Gang before crossing the hills around the valley. We finally ride back into Muang Sing. Trip ends here. The group can ride back on the support vehicle to Luang Namtha or stay in Muang Sing.
Approximately: 1 ½ transfer/5 - 6 hours biking
